HP Pavilion All-in-One - 24-r014
Microsoft Windows 10 (64-bit)

When gaming, there are moments when I need to use the Shift key to crouch, sprint, etc. Sometimes, I manage to press Ctrl + Shift + S + D simultaneously, and it turns my screen black, displaying "Check HDMI-In Cable." Pressing this hotkey once more, it returns to normal, with the top of the computer saying "Active Port: PC." The reason why this is a problem is that it's super annoying and it interferes with whatever I was doing. I looked at other related posts and found one that pointed out you can't disable it; refer to this post: https://www.bestbuy.com/site/questions/hp-pavilion-24-touch-screen-all-in-one-intel-core-i5-12gb-mem.... There were no further responses, so I'm now asking if there's at least a way to override this hotkey. Thanks a lot.

You're not alone in finding this shortcut disruptive—with the Ctrl + Shift + S + D hotkey triggering a switch to the HDMI-In port. 

 

Unfortunately, based on HP’s documentation and community feedback, this hotkey is hardcoded into the system firmware and cannot be disabled or remapped through Windows settings or HP software.
